How Ios 11 4 1 Limits Usb Accessories To Make Your Iphone And Ipad More Secure

The iOS 11.4.1 update includes a new security feature that restricts the way USB accessories can interact with iPhone and iPad devices. If the phone has not been unlocked within the last hour, iOS will disable the Lightning port so USB accessories cannot communicate with the device. After unlocking, any accessories will stay connected. USB power chargers are not affected, but some USB accessories that provide power may not charge the device until the device has been unlocked....

Haven T Made Your New Year S Resolutions No Worries You Re Not Alone

Social chatter around New Year’s resolutions has been, to be honest, slow to get off the ground in 2020. We used Sprout Social Advanced Listening to learn what was causing this muted response and found only 27,208 messages across Twitter, Instagram, YouTube and Reddit from November 14-December 14. For comparison, one month’s worth of data on Halloween generated 13 million messages across Twitter alone.
